A sink strainer is a kitchen accessory designed to prevent food particles and debris from clogging drains. It fits into the sink's drain hole, allowing water to flow through while trapping solids.

Choosing the right sink strainer can significantly enhance your kitchen experience. Here are some key points to consider when selecting a sink strainer:
  • Material: Opt for durable materials like stainless steel or silicone that resist corrosion and wear.
  • Size: Ensure it fits your sink's drain hole perfectly for optimal performance.
  • Design: Look for designs that allow easy removal for cleaning.

FAQs

How can I choose the best sink strainer for my needs?

Consider the size of your sink drain, the material of the strainer, and whether you prefer a removable design for easy cleaning.

What are the key features to look for when selecting sink strainers?

Look for durability, a good fit for your sink, and ease of cleaning. Stainless steel and silicone are popular materials.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ing sink strainers?

Many people overlook the size compatibility with their sink drain, which can lead to ineffective filtering.

How often should I clean my sink strainer?

It's best to clean your sink strainer regularly, ideally every few days, to prevent buildup and maintain hygiene.

Can a sink strainer help prevent plumbing issues?

Yes, a sink strainer effectively captures food particles and debris, reducing the risk of clogs and plumbing problems.
